Oct 22, 2016 · L’s energy future is guided by the Power Strategic Long-Term Resource Plan (SLTRP), a roadmap for providing reliable and sustainable electricity to our customers with a 25-year planning horizon, while also transitioning to a 100% carbon-free power supply by 2035. Over the next 10 to 15 years, LADWP will eliminate the use of coal power to reduce greenhouse gas emissions, expand renewable energy to 33 percent of power sales by 2020, and increase energy efficiency to reduce electricity use by 15 percent by 2020.
